Jaiprakash Power Ventures (JPPOWER) is currently navigating a challenging landscape marked by legal and regulatory pressures, particularly related to ongoing investigations and insolvency proceedings involving its parent company. Management's focus on operational efficiency through technology upgrades and energy-efficient initiatives is crucial for enhancing margins and maintaining competitive positioning. Vista's financial outlook anticipates accelerating revenue growth, supported by India's rising power demand, particularly from data centers and industrial sectors. The company's commitment to financial discipline and strategic asset optimization aligns with Vista's expectations of improving profitability and stable cash flows. However, the successful execution of the Resolution Plan and management of regulatory risks will be pivotal in determining future performance. The power utilities sector is experiencing expansion, driven by increasing electricity demand, although competitive pricing pressures may impact margins. Over the next 12-24 months, key opportunities include leveraging technological advancements and optimizing asset utilization, while watchpoints include regulatory compliance and fuel cost management. Overall, Vista's forecast reflects a balanced view of potential upside, with a target price indicating modest appreciation in share value

Company Overview
Show Company Profile
Jaiprakash Power Ventures Limited engages in the power generation and cement grinding businesses in India. It generates electricity through thermal and hydro energy sources. The company owns and operates a 400 megawatts (MW) Jaypee Vishnuprayag hydro-electric power plant at District Chamoli, Uttarakhand; 1320 MW Jaypee Nigrie thermal power plant at village Nigrie, district Singrauli, Madhya Pradesh; and 500 MW Jaypee Bina thermal power plant at village Sirchopi, district Sagar, Madhya Pradesh. In addition, it operates coal mine located in Amelia and Bandha Madhya Pradesh. The company was formerly known as Jaiprakash Hydro-Power Limited and changed its name to Jaiprakash Power Ventures Limited in December 2009. Jaiprakash Power Ventures Limited was incorporated in 1994 and is based in New Delhi, India.
